To open the General tab, select Account > Account Settings > General tab.

Calendar Settings

Setting Description
Display flag icon on appointment

Show the flag icon on Calendar appointments when a patient has a flag in their chart or appointment. Go to Patients > Patient Flags to create and edit patient flags. See the image in the next row.
What do the lock and flag icons on my appointments mean?
Display lock icon on appointment Show the lock icon on the Calendar appointment when the clinical note is locked.
What do the lock and flag icons on my appointments mean?
Use new dashboard homescreen Set the Dashboard or the Calendar as your default landing page. If you set the Dashboard as the default landing page in Account Settings, it's also set in Dashboard Settings.
Show user satisfaction survey Opt in to receiving user satisfaction surveys.
Default Office Set the default office in the Calendar. The default office determines which office location is listed in the provider’s contact information on documents such as referrals and C-CDA files.

MIPS Decision Support Intervention

Use the Severity Level of Interventions setting to specify which severity levels appear for drug-to-drug and drug-to-allergy interactions.

Patient Vitals

Use the Patient Vitals settings to choose default units—metric or customary—for weight, height, head circumference, and temperature when entering vital signs.

Use Organization Name On Reminders and Onpatient Invites Show the organization name on reminders or OnPatient invites. Enter your practice/organization name in the Organization Name box.
To turn this setting on, create a support case to create a administrative role.

When this setting is turned on, the Organization Name box appears and the Recorded Provider Name is replaced by Recorded Organization Name.

Recorded Provider Name You can record your name, which is played during the voice reminder when announcing you as the provider. For example: “You have an appointment with [recorded name] on Wednesday.”
